Base package for electronic invoicing MCP servers.
Provides shared Pydantic models, EN 16931 invoice tree, UBL/CII wire format serializers, an OAuth2 HTTP client, Peppol SMP lookup, digital signature primitives, and a compliance audit framework so country-specific packages share a common foundation without duplicating code.

Installation
pip install mcp-einvoicing-core
For the compliance audit framework (used by country package CI):
pip install mcp-einvoicing-core[audit]
For XSLT 2.0/3.0 Schematron validation (SaxonSchematronValidator — needed for Schematron
rule sets using XPath 2.0+ constructs, e.g. FNFE-MPE Factur-X 1.08 / ZUGFeRD):
pip install mcp-einvoicing-core[xslt2]
Architecture
Country packages subclass the core abstractions and register their tools on a shared or standalone MCP server:
mcp-einvoicing-core
├── EN16931Invoice / InvoiceDocument ← canonical invoice models
├── EN16931CreditNote ← credit note (type codes 381/383/384/385)
├── EN16931UBL/CII Serializer/Parser ← wire format round-trip
├── convert_wire_format ← CII ↔ UBL conversion
├── BaseDocumentGenerator/Validator/Parser/LifecycleManager
├── BaseEInvoicingClient ← async HTTP (OAuth2/mTLS/bearer/API key)
├── PeppolSMPClient ← participant lookup via SMP/SML
├── PeppolTransmitter ← AS4 outbound transmission
├── BaseDocumentSigner ← XAdES-EPES / XMLDSig
├── BaseEnvironmentEndpoints ← sandbox/production URL routing
├── RoutingIdentifier ← country-specific routing ID validation
├── EInvoicingMCPServer ← plugin registry wrapping FastMCP
└── Audit framework ← per-package compliance checks
Country packages
| Country | Package | Standard |
|---|---|---|
| France | mcp-facture-electronique-fr | NF XP Z12-012 / NF XP Z12-013 / Factur-X / UBL 2.1 / CII |
| Germany | mcp-einvoicing-de | ZUGFeRD 2.x / XRechnung 3.x |
| Belgium | mcp-einvoicing-be | Peppol BIS 3.0 / PINT-BE |
| Italy | mcp-fattura-elettronica-it | FatturaPA / SDI |
| Poland | mcp-ksef-pl | KSeF FA(3) / FA(2) / Peppol BIS 3.0 |
| Spain | mcp-facturacion-electronica-es | Factura-e / VeriFactu / SII / FACe |
| Brazil | mcp-nfe-br | NF-e / NFC-e (modelo 55/65, schema 4.00) / NFS-e Nacional |
Plugin registration pattern
Country packages register their tools on a shared or standalone FastMCP instance:
# Standalone
from fastmcp import FastMCP
mcp = FastMCP(name="mcp-fattura-elettronica-it", instructions="...")
register_header_tools(mcp)
register_body_tools(mcp)
register_global_tools(mcp)
# Multi-country (optional EInvoicingMCPServer)
from mcp_einvoicing_core import EInvoicingMCPServer
server = EInvoicingMCPServer(name="mcp-einvoicing-eu", instructions="...")
server.register_plugin(register_header_tools, "it-header")
server.register_plugin(register_flow_tools, "fr-flow")
server.run()
